Our client is a specialist consultancy operating across energy markets, analytics, and investment advisory. The team supports clients with market analysis, asset valuation, optimisation, and strategic insight across evolving power and gas markets. They are seeking a Technical Analyst to join their growing technical team, contributing to quantitative modelling, research, and analytical platform development. This role is ideal for someone with strong energy market knowledge, advanced modelling capability, and solid programming skills who enjoys solving complex commercial problems.

Key Responsibilities

  • Develop and enhance models for asset valuation, dispatch optimisation, and revenue forecasting across energy markets
  • Build and maintain price forecasting and scenario analysis models
  • Conduct market analysis to support short- and long-term pricing views
  • Develop internal analytical tools, automation workflows, and data infrastructure
  • Manage SQL-based datasets and improve modelling efficiency through process optimisation
  • Apply AI tools to support research and analytical workflows
  • Translate technical outputs into clear commercial insights for clients and stakeholders
  • Collaborate across a technically focused and research-driven team environment

Requirements

  • 3–5 years' experience in energy markets, quantitative analysis, or related sectors
  • Strong Python programming skills
  • Experience with optimisation, statistical modelling, or forecasting techniques
  • Understanding of asset valuation and energy market dynamics
  • Strong SQL and data handling capability
  • Experience working with structured datasets, pipelines, or analytical platforms
  • Strong communication and problem-solving skills
  • Degree in a quantitative discipline such as engineering, mathematics, physics, or similar
  • Experience within consulting, advisory, trading, or investment environments
  • Familiarity with cloud platforms or modern data infrastructure
  • Knowledge of risk analysis or transaction modelling within energy markets
